Liverpool still remains the only standout performers this season and still remain the only premier league team that hasn’t lost any match so far and haven’t dropped more than 2 points so far this season. It has been a remarkable upward motion for the Reds, reaching the finals of the champions league 2 seasons ago, winning it last season and narrowly losing out of the premier league title and now, they are already over 14 points clear at the top of the premier league table and without a doubt clear favourites to run away with the premier league title this season. They are still in the champions league but their main priority still remains to make history by winning their first-ever premier league title and having that trophy in their cabinet as one of the most successful clubs in English football. Liverpool face a tricky test at home against Sheff United who have been pretty impressive as a newly promoted side this season. However, Liverpool are expected to get the job done as it is very difficult to pick any team who can stop Liverpool at the moment.

Sheff United like I said above have impressed a lot this season with the way they’ve performed in most of their games so far, including the ones they’ve dropped points. They have their own style of play which is working for them as they aim to impress and try to be the first team to stop Liverpool this season. They are currently sitting 8th on the premier league table and an unbelievable win later today against Liverpool would put them above Spurs who are in 6th. A very difficult game for the Blades away from home, and even though they are the underdogs in this fixture, they cannot be completely written off as we all know that football is filled with a lot of surprises and also the Blades have the qualities to upset Liverpool if they put in a performance above 100%.

Expected formation and tactics – Sheff Unied will be expected to set up in a 3-5-2 formation. Their gameplan in this game will most likely be to be very tight at the back and try to utilize their qualities in the wide areas, crosses into the box and set pieces to cause Liverpool problems.
